How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    The Role
    This position sits within the manufacturing quality function and is responsible for verifying the accuracy and consistency of precision-engineered components produced both in-house and by external suppliers. The role plays a key part in maintaining high manufacturing standards by ensuring components meet specifications before progressing through the production process.

    You’ll work closely with production, engineering, and supply chain teams to support robust quality control and continuous improvement across operations.

    This is an afternoon/evening shift.

    Key Duties & Responsibilities

    * Carry out detailed inspections on machined components at various stages of production, including initial setups, final outputs, and parts sent for subcontract processing.

    * Confirm all components conform to technical drawings, specifications, and tolerance requirements.

    * Review and verify that the latest engineering revisions are being used, escalating discrepancies where necessary.

    * Perform routine in-process checks to ensure inspection records and operator documentation are completed accurately.

    * Support the management and upkeep of inspection tools and measurement equipment, ensuring calibration schedules are maintained.

    * Coordinate with procurement and suppliers to manage outsourced processes and confirm returned components meet quality standards.

    * Work in accordance with established quality management systems, including ISO standards and internal procedures.

    * Promote and adhere to all company policies relating to health, safety, quality, and environmental compliance.

    Skills, Knowledge & Experience
    Strong background in inspection and quality assurance within a manufacturing environment.

    Confident using a wide range of inspection equipment, including micrometers, verniers, gauges, and portable measurement systems.

    Previous exposure to CNC machining or precision engineering environments is highly desirable.

    Ability to accurately interpret technical drawings and manufacturing documentation.

    Comfortable using computer systems for recording and reporting inspection data.

    Salary
    £25,000 – £38,000 per annum, depending on experience
